Everything You Need To Know About Homogenisers

homogenisers are a crucial piece of equipment in various industries, from food processing to pharmaceuticals. They are used to break down particles and create a uniform mixture by applying mechanical force. In this article, we will explore the ins and outs of homogenisers, their benefits, and how they are used in different industries.

homogenisers work by forcing a product through a narrow space under high pressure, causing the particles to break down and become smaller. This process distributes the particles evenly throughout the mixture, creating a consistent product. homogenisers can be used for a variety of applications, including mixing, emulsifying, and dispersing.

In the food industry, homogenisers are commonly used to create products such as milk, mayonnaise, and salad dressings. By breaking down fat globules into smaller particles, homogenisers create a smooth and creamy texture in these products. They are also used to mix ingredients thoroughly, ensuring a consistent taste and texture in the final product.

In the pharmaceutical industry, homogenisers play a vital role in the production of medications. They are used to mix active ingredients with carriers, ensuring that each dose contains the correct amount of medication. Homogenisers also help create stable emulsions and suspensions, which are essential in the formulation of pharmaceutical products.

When choosing a homogeniser for your production process, it is essential to consider factors such as the desired particle size, processing capacity, and the viscosity of the product. There are different types of homogenisers available, including high-pressure homogenisers, ultrasonic homogenisers, and rotor-stator homogenisers. Each type has its unique features and capabilities, so it is essential to select the right one for your specific needs.
